Summary

On April 13, 2002, [redacted] was sitting on the stoop of her home, located at [redacted] in the Bronx, when Lieutenant DeEntremont, Sergeant Melendez, and Officers Roman and Finn instructed the people on the block, including [redacted] to move. When [redacted] argued, Lieutenant DeEntremont said, "mind your business you three teeth bitch." [redacted] continued to talk and refused to move and was arrested [redacted]
On April 15, 2002, [redacted] was standing in front of her building when the same four officers drove by and Sergeant Melendez, who was sitting in the back seat, gave [redacted] the middle finger through the car window. [redacted] Read report for details.
